The Psychology of Luck
Psychology plays an instrumental role in how gamblers perceive luck. Many players subscribe to the belief in lucky charms or rituals, which can enhance their confidence and potentially influence their results. This phenomenon, known as the «illusion of control,» can affect not only individual performance but also the overall atmosphere of a casino.
Studies indicate that believing in one’s luck can lead to increased risk-taking behaviors. This can sometimes result in bigger wins, but it can also lead to substantial losses. As such, a balanced approach to gambling is essential.
Strategies to Enhance Luck
While luck is inherently random, players often seek strategies to maximize their chances of winning. Here are a few tips that can help:
- Choose the Right Games: Some games have better odds than others. Informing yourself about the return-to-player (RTP) percentages can guide your game choices.
- Manage Your Bankroll: Establishing a budget and sticking to it can help prolong your gaming experience and increase your chances of hitting a lucky streak.
- Know When to Walk Away: Recognizing when to stop playing is crucial. Whether on a winning or losing streak, setting limits helps mitigate losses and preserves winnings.
The Myth of Lucky Numbers and Colors
In the realm of casinos, many players find themselves gravitating toward certain numbers or colors they consider lucky. Superstitions abound, with players often choosing numbers based on personal significance or cultural beliefs. However, it’s essential to remember that the outcomes of most casino games are entirely random.
This doesn’t diminish the enjoyment of playing; rather, it highlights the unique relationship between players and their perception of luck. Engaging in these rituals can enhance the experience, even if they do not affect the actual likelihood of winning.
